National Park Liwonde, located at 205 km) South-East of Lilongwe is the best national Park in the country, it is well managed by a special detachment of Rangers and is famous for a good diversity of its inhabitants, and the beautiful scenery. Being South of lake Malawi, it includes part of the lake shore and the river Wider. Thousands of hippos and crocodiles living in the water of ponds, as well as numerous herds of elephants - the pride and face of the Park, there are several varieties of antelope and two species of rhinoceros, as well as a large colony of birds. Most animals can be spotted in the Northern, lakeside Park. A large area of the Park is closed during wet season (April to October), although the main cabin and tourist camps are open year-round, but access to them will be opened only boat on the water.
